While it is true that the combination of >=changeset 1084 in combination with the updated lakewalker-plugin is a working combination, the solution to the problem is not as straightforward as given.
After updating to a changeset >=1084, josm hangs at the splash screen giving the java.lang.NoSuchFieldError: shortCut; that is there is no way to "simply hit update". On the other hand, after reverting to a <changeset 1084 and updating the plugins from that version, josm hangs at the splash screen on java.lang.NoClassDefFoundError: org/openstreetmap/josm/tools/Shortcut.
The only way (of course apart from manually downloading the correct set of jar-files prior to launching anything) I have found to correct the solution is to first update the plugins from a <1084 josm and with these in place update to a changeset >=1084 (and never look back...). This makes the "more or less stable" changeset utterly unstable *smile*
That is, there is no problem in code, but there might be a problem in information flow....
